If location really doesn't matter, for 210 points you can probably do better through resale at OKW or SSR.

But what do you mean by "off time"? Point costs are lowest between Thanksgiving and Christmas, and because of that DVC owners like to book their trips during that time. It might be hard to book at VWL, BCV, or BWV during that timeframe.

May, on the other hand, is easier to book. I easily got into BCV at seven months for our upcoming trip in May. But point costs in May are higher.
 

All of January and all of September are also part of Adventure Season(lowest point requirements), most of November and December(excluding holidays) plus all of October are part Choice season which very close to adventure season requirements(actually the same in some cases).

I think SSR, VWL and BCV are almost always better off buying direct from Disney, after you factor in Closing Costs and value of available/stripped points. And if you do find one where the numbers make sense, ROFR is a huge probability.

OKW, it would be crazy to buy direct from Disney. Resale prices are WELL BELOW retail and there is always a huge supply of points.

BWV depends, just crunch the numbers because I have seen some deals that would have been better off paying full retail and others that were very good deals compared to retail.

Just remember to add Closing cost if any, I devide by the number of points and apply it.
Also calculate the number and value of points missing or banked with the resale compared to direct from disney. Disney right now is still giving the 2005 points when you purchase(dues are prorated, can be free depending on use year).
